ABOUT COACHING

Did you know most youth soccer coaches, particularly of teams in younger age groups, are volunteers recruited from among the parents of players? The vast majority of them had no experience at all when they started, and learned as they went along. In addition to developing a love of the sport, they discovered a fun and enjoyable way to participate in the lives of their children. Believe it or not, some got so hooked that, even though their kids are grown, they volunteer to coach teams of young players just because they enjoy it! They are, however, not in such plentiful supply that you can assume you won't be contacted about volunteering as a coach or to help your child's coach. Here are 2 important things for you to consider:

  • Although some parents may initially be reluctant to participate as coaches because they feel they don't know enough about the sport of soccer, it is generally true that they know more than their 6, 7, or 8-year-old child and his or her friends.
  • Although some parents may be reluctant to participate as coaches because they feel they lack coaching experience, invariably they discover that having the support of our Board of Directors, who are committed to ensuring that FLSC coaches have rewarding and enjoyable experiences, alleviates any initial concerns they may have had.

When the call comes, please consider supporting your child's development in this very special way. See you on the pitch!
